  1. 1 Whether the judgment debtor met the threshold for leave to pay the decretal sum by monthly instalments of Ksh.50,000
  2. 2 Whether the court should instead impose a different instalment structure
  3. 3 Who should bear the costs of the application

Ratio Decidendi

The Defendant failed to prove sufficient, objective financial difficulty or a fair and reasonable basis for the specific proposal of Ksh.50,000 per month, especially in light of the long execution history and her conduct in multiple unsuccessful attempts to forestall execution. However, the Plaintiffs’ concession made a shorter instalment arrangement equitable, so the court adopted four equal monthly instalments instead of the Defendant’s proposed terms.

Court Disposition

Application dismissed as filed, but court granted alternative instalment relief on terms set by the Plaintiffs

Orders

  • The outstanding decretal sum shall be paid in four equal monthly instalments.
  • The first instalment shall be paid on or before 30th July, 2026.
